Children often have to deal with the mistakes of the adults in their lives. There are many instances and situations that many young children are forced into and are forced to deal with, as the realities of life and responsibility can often intrude on the idealistic peaceful improvement of a child. Children that take extra comfort in play often have tumultuous lives and experiences of their own, so seeing solace is important.

Play therapy is especially beneficial for children dealing with parental divorce or divorce, any form of abuse, adoption, nurture care, hospitalization or illness, witnessing domestic violence or other forms of trauma, serious accidents, loss of a loved one, or any other situation that can take an emotional toll on a child. Escaping to a safe and happy place is important in these situations, if only for a few moments.

Signs to Watch For

Watching for signs of trouble within children is one of the agonizing realities of life and can be complicated. There are numerous signs to watch for in kids that may propose that there is some internal trouble, however, and that play therapy would be a suitable choice to help the child flee and overcome the negative feelings.

If a child is experiencing especially aggressive behavior, sleep problems, elimination problems, eating difficulties, school problems, issues with learning, divorce anxiety, sexual preoccupation, or general difficulty adjusting to a change in house situation, play therapy may be an option.

Play Therapy Options

There are a amount of options when it comes to play therapy. These options will, of course, depend on the child and on the nature of the situation. Playing with stuffed animals and having someone else "voice" to talk to is often a great outlet for a child, as he or she can discuss his or her deepest fears and feelings with a stuffed bear or bunny.

Dollhouses, dolls, or other construction-type toys are also excellent ideas for play therapy. This allows the child to generate and exist within a distinct realm, if only for a few minutes. This form of practical escapism is a great choice for children with serious difficulties within their lives and can be a real blessing for them.
